Babasaheb Bhimrao Ambedkar University (BBAU) will release the BBAU CUET 2025 cutoff on its official website, bbau.ac.in. The university offers admission to different UG programmes at its Main Campus in Lucknow. BBAU releases separate merit lists for the main campus and satellite centre. As NTA has declared the results for the CUET 2025 exam, Babasaheb Bhimrao Ambedkar University will soon start its admission process and CUET counselling in different slots through online mode.

Aspiring candidates seeking admission at BBAU through CUET must register and pay the required counselling fee to take part in the counselling process. Registered candidates who have their names on the merit list will also have to verify their documents on the Samarth portal and pay the admission fee by the last date to avoid losing their admission at the university.

Q:   How is CUET UG cut off calculated?
A:

The CUET UG cut off is determined by CUET participating universities seperately. Parameters on the basis of which CUET UG cut off is released are:

  • Total number of candidates that appeared for the CUET UG exam
  • The number of seats offered by the participating universities through CUET UG
  • The difficulty level of the CUET exam
  • Overall performance of the test takers (pass percentage/ score range, etc.)

CUET cut off is based on the percentile of the candidate. To calculate the CUET percentile following formula is applied:

100*Number of candidates appeared in the session with a raw score is equal to or less than a candidate/ total number of candidates appeared for CUET UG.

Q:   When will NTA release CUET UG cutoff?
A:

National Testing Agency (NTA) does not release the CUET UG cutoff. Once the CUET results are declared, the socres are shared with the participating universities and role of NTA ends with the declaration of results. CUET UG 2025 cutoff will be released by the CUET participtaing universities seperatley. Candidates will be able to check the course wise and category wise cutoff. Q:   How is CUET normalized score calculated?
A:

The CUET (Common University Entrance Test) normalised scores are derived through a systematic process that ensures fairness across different testing sessions. Here’s a detailed breakdown of how these scores are calculated:

  1. Raw Marks Collection: Initially, each candidate's raw marks are collected after they complete the exam. These marks represent the number of correct answers each candidate achieved.

  2. Percentile Calculation: For each candidate, their percentile is calculated based on how their raw marks compare to those of other candidates who took the exam in the same session. This percentile indicates the relative standing of a candidate among their peers within that specific session.

  3. Session Equating: The process involves multiple testing sessions that may occur over several days for the same subject. The percentiles calculated for each session are then equated to ensure consistency in scoring across all sessions.

  4. Normalisation Process: After equating the percentiles, they are converted into normalised marks. This step helps to standardise scores across varying exam conditions and candidate populations.

  5. Handling Smaller Sessions: In instances where a session has a limited number of candidates, those scores are aggregated with larger sessions. This clubbing ensures that every candidate's performance is compared against a more substantial and diverse group, leading to a more reliable and equitable normalised score.
